Often the foliage is blue-green, aromatic, and arranged in scale-like leaves along the branches. Juniper berries may be present throughout the growing season. \u003cspan data-contrast=\"auto\" class=\"TextRun SCXW174687755 BCX0\" xml:lang=\"EN-US\" lang=\"EN-US\"\u003e\u003cspan class=\"NormalTextRun SCXW174687755 BCX0\"\u003eJunipers do best in average, well-drained soils in full sun. They are intolerant of wet conditions. 'Grey Owl' is a beautiful cultivar of red cedar with silvery-gray foliage and wonderful aroma when brushed against. It makes an excellent specimen or plant for massing due to its wide spreading habit.
